PIMCO CA Sh Dur Municipal Income A Overview

PIMCO CA Sh Dur Municipal Income A (PCDAX) is an actively managed Municipal Bond Muni Single State Short fund. PIMCO launched the fund in 2006.

The investment seeks maximum total return, consistent with preservation of capital and prudent investment management. The fund invests at least 80% of its assets in debt securities whose interest is, in the opinion of bond counsel for the issuer at the time of issuance, exempt from federal and California income tax. It invests primarily in investment grade debt securities, but may invest up to 10% of its total assets in junk bonds that are rated Caa or higher by Moody's, or equivalently rated by S&P or Fitch, or, if unrated, determined by PIMCO to be of comparable quality. The fund may invest in derivative instruments.

Assets Under Management

The fund has $21 million in total assets, which is below the $238 million average for the Muni Single State Short category. Normally, lower assets under management translates to higher average expense ratios, and greater total assets are desired. However, for some investment categories, such as small-cap investing, it may be difficult for the manager to fully employ the desired active strategy if assets grow too large or too quickly.

PCDAX Performance and Fees

The expense ratio measures how much of a fund’s assets are used for administrative expenses and operating expenses, including adviser fees and fees for the transfer agent and custodial services. The PIMCO CA Sh Dur Municipal Income A expense ratio is above average compared to funds in the Muni Single State Short category. PIMCO CA Sh Dur Municipal Income A has an expense ratio of 0.73%, which is 12% higher than its category average, making the fund expense ratio grade a D. While it is difficult to predict returns, it is known that high annual expense ratios reduce your rate of return, and excessive fees are difficult to overcome. Active management normally comes with higher expense ratios than passive index management. Certain investment categories such as small company and foreign also normally have higher expense ratios. It is best to compare fund expense ratios against the category averages for meaningful assessments.

High portfolio turnover can translate to higher expenses and lower aftertax returns. PIMCO CA Sh Dur Municipal Income A has a portfolio turnover rate of 47%, indicating that holds its assets around 0.0 years. By way of comparison, the average portfolio turnover is 43% for the Muni Single State Short category.

Recently, in the month of July 2026, PIMCO CA Sh Dur Municipal Income A returned -0.4%, which earned it a grade of B, as the Muni Single State Short category had an average return of -0.7%. The letter grades of A, B, C, D and F are based upon relative rankings within the investment category. A grade of A, for example, would indicate that the return is in the highest 20% for that time period compared to all funds in that category.
